Abstract

The present invention provides a kind of multifunctional comfortable sport footwear, including shoe last surface, sole and shoe-pad, the shoe last surface is fixedly linked in sole foaming forming process with sole, shoe-pad detachable device is on sole, the shoe last surface includes flap, preceding upper, upper and two lateral wall faces afterwards, the shoe last surface also includes elastic ankle guard water band, palm protector band, first elastic bag, air-guide main tube and some air-guide branch pipes, the rear upper is high side structure, the elastic ankle guard water band is located on the port of rear upper, the air-guide main tube extends to the toe position of preceding upper from flap, the air-guide branch pipe connects setting along air-guide main tube at equal intervals, first elastic bag accesses air-guide main tube, the palm protector band has fixing end and movable end, and fixing end and movable end set up separately on two lateral wall faces.The rear upper of the present invention uses high side structure, wraps up ankle, prevents ankle from sprains, elastic ankle guard water band has excellent elasticity, can produce elastic deformation to buffer impulse force of the pin to footwear.

Background technology
What the characteristics of being taken exercises during sport footwear according to people manufactured and designed, the intense physical exercises of highlight lines necessarily cause sole Perspire serious so that all sultry humidity of whole footwear chamber, causes feel uncomfortable, and motion it is persistently easy pin class disease.In addition, acute Sport footwear damping performance is not good enough during strong motion, easily causes medicine or even sprains one's ankle.Therefore, sport footwear is more focused on Performance is concentrated mainly on gas permeability and damping property, and general realized by grid shoe last surface of the existing shoes of in the market strengthens shoes Gas permeability, although certain gas permeability can be played, but foot is perspired since sole, so air permeable sole seems particularly It is important, however existing athletic shoe sole only larger transformation is carried out in damping resilience, gas permeability is not generally good, in addition in view of This, the applicant furthers investigate for the fault of construction of existing sole, there is this case generation then.

Embodiment
To describe the technology contents of the present invention in detail, feature, the objects and the effects being constructed, below in conjunction with embodiment And coordinate accompanying drawing to be explained in detail.Coordinate X, Y, Z represent the fore-and-aft direction, left and right directions and above-below direction of shoes respectively in figure.
Shown in reference picture 1,2, the present invention provides a kind of multifunctional comfortable sport footwear, including shoe last surface, sole and shoe-pad, The shoe last surface is fixedly linked in sole foaming forming process with sole, and shoe-pad detachable device is on sole.The upper of a shoe bread Flap, preceding upper, rear upper and two lateral wall faces are included, the shoe last surface also includes elastic ankle guard water band 41, palm protector band 42, first Elastic bag 43, air-guide main tube 44 and some air-guide branch pipes 45.The elastic ankle guard water band 41 is made up of elastomeric material and water, The elastic ring of ankle guard water band 41 is located on the port of rear upper, specifically, can be utilized toward water is injected in elastomeric material after making Strong binding is gluing to be attached in rear upper.Elastic ankle guard water band 41 itself has excellent elasticity, can produce elastic deformation with slow The water rushed in impulse force of the pin to footwear, and elastic ankle guard water band 41 has mobility, also can be with stress deformation, the end of so rear upper Mouth soft comfortable, will not cause feel uncomfortable, and have excellent buffering effect concurrently due to knocking pin.
The palm protector band 42 has fixing end and movable end, and fixing end and movable end set up separately on two lateral wall faces, and And the palm protector band 42 lid is located on the flap, specifically, the movable end is provided with Velcro generatrix, the lateral wall face correspondence evil spirit Art mother buckle face is provided with magic clasp face.Palm protector band 42 can be glutinous tight according to the size of pin, strengthens fixing the encapsulation of pin so that footwear Chamber can reach the size for most adapting to pin, not tight not loose, improve comfort level.
The air-guide main tube 44 extends to the toe position of preceding upper from flap, and the two ends of air-guide main tube 44 are not close setting, And communicated with the external world, the air-guide branch pipe 45 connects setting at equal intervals along air-guide main tube 44, specifically, in the toe position of preceding upper Provided with air-guide branch pipe 45.
Preferably, each surface of air-guide branch pipe 45 is additionally provided with several gas port (not shown), and gas port contributes to gas Circulation.First elastic bag 43 accesses air-guide main tube 44, and first elastic bag 43 is located at below palm protector band 42, i.e., and first Elastic bag 43 is folded between palm protector band 42 and flap, in this, and pin will extrude flap during foot-up so that the first elastic bag 43 deform because by the double sided pressure of flap and palm protector band 42, just energy air-blowing during deformation, so that in air-guide main tube 44 and air guide Circulation airflow is formed in branch pipe 45, formed air-flow can Quick diffusing heat, be also beneficial to dry sweat, reach that rapid perspiration is saturating The effect of gas.
Preferably, the guiding gutter that the upper surface of the palm protector band 42 extends provided with several along upper structure left and right directions 48, will directly be dropped on guiding gutter 48 when water droplet is to flap, guiding gutter 48 can direct water towards shoes both sides, can avoid water from Flap is flowed into footwear.
More selection of land, the upper structure also includes two panels inverted U TPU bluff pieces 46 and two panels V-type TPU bluff pieces 47, using height The TPU of hardness making, with preferable stability.Two panels inverted U TPU bluff pieces 46 set up separately in rear upper both sides, specifically, The turn of bilge of inverted U TPU bluff pieces 46 is set close to the port of rear upper, can withstand ankle, so that stable ankle.Two panels V-type TPU Bluff piece 47 sets up the toe position in two lateral wall faces separately, and the bending part of V-type TPU bluff pieces 47 is located at toe joint, in this way, doing V-type TPU bluff pieces 47 can play a protective role to toe during violent bounce motion, and bending part bends space to toe, very It is convenient.
As shown in figure 3, there is the shoe-pad sole body, closure to be located at the first air-permeable mattress of sole body toe portion 11 and closure be located at the second air-permeable mattress 12 of sole body heel position, closure setting tool body can use strength binder Bonding etc., there is one layer of ventilative nonwoven layer on air-permeable mattress surface, and footwear chamber passes through nonwoven layer and aeration.The sole sheet Body is provided with the first cavity volume 13 and the second cavity volume 14 in toe portion and heel position respectively, and the left and right sides of the first cavity volume 13 is set There is ventilation mouth 132, sole body is ventilated by the ventilation mouth 132 with extraneous.
The cavity volume 14 of first cavity volume 13 and second is respectively equipped with several first ventilative columns 131 and several ventilative outer tubes 141, it is preferable that several described first ventilative columns 131 set at least two row and arranged along the fore-and-aft direction of sole body, institute State several ventilative outer tubes 141 to set at least four row and arrange along the fore-and-aft direction of sole body, each row first are breathed freely column 131 and the equally spaced arrangement of ventilative outer tube 141.
As shown in figure 4, the first ventilative upper end of column 131 is provided with trapezoidal shape groove 1311, first air-permeable mattress 11 The projection trapezoidal shape projection 111 of surface matching trapezoidal shape groove 1311, trapezoidal shape groove 1311 can be completely fitted with trapezoidal projection, should The middle part of trapezoidal shape projection 111 is provided with the air-vent 1111 of up/down perforation, trapezoidal shape projection 111 and trapezoidal shape groove during foot-up There is gap between 1311,1111 and first cavity volume of air-vent, 13 left and right sides using the gap, trapezoidal shape projection 111 are saturating Gas port 132 can form an air communication channel so that sole top directly can ventilate with the external world, reach Quick-air-drying toe The effect of position sweat, the first shoe-pad stress is to sinking when trampling so that trapezoidal shape projection 111 blocks trapezoidal shape groove 1311, Now, air duct is just blocked, and then plays waterproof action.
As shown in Figure 5,6, the lower end inside the ventilative outer tube 141 is fixedly connected with the second elastic bag 1411, second bullet Property air bag 1411 opening up setting, the lower surface of the second air-permeable mattress 12 is provided with the second ventilative column 121, and this is second ventilative vertical The ventilative outer tube 141 of middle part correspondence of post 121 is provided with the ventilative inner tube 1211 of up/down perforation, and ventilative inner tube 1211 is inserted in ventilative outer In pipe 141, breathe freely inner tube 1211 length will be with the second elastic bag 1411 diameter, when the first air-permeable mattress 11 does not stress breathe freely Second elastic bag when the lower end of inner tube 1211 can only just contradict the upper surface, i.e. nature of the second elastic bag 1411 1411 is not compact, and the lower end of inner tube 1211 of being breathed freely during stress extrudes the second elastic bag 1411.
When trampling after heel stress the second elastic bag 1411 by outlet after the extruding of ventilative inner tube 1211, even if One cavity volume 13 can not breathe freely, and by the second elastic bag 1411 to the tonifying Qi inside sole, can accelerate the air stream inside sole It is logical, during foot-up heel do not stress the second elastic bag 1411 it is not compact after can air-breathing shrink, now, suction is from the first cavity volume The air entered in 13, the gas that breathing process can allow the first cavity volume 13 to transmit passes to the second cavity volume 14 so that whole sole Ventilating air is filled with, and breathing process accelerates air velocity, is conducive to accelerating air circulation.To sum up, the present invention passes through Organic cooperation of first cavity volume 13 and the second cavity volume 14, sole is used on sport footwear, allows the motion shoes lumen moment to maintain The air of circulation, so that footwear intracavitary is difficult sultry, can keep dry and comfortable feel.
Thumb joint part stress than it is larger and it is easy sprain, as shown in figure 8, the insole body also include be located at The shock structure 24 of sole body big toe joint part, the shock structure 24 is included along the vertical of sole body above-below direction extension Post 241 and the transverse post 242 extended along sole body fore-and-aft direction, the top and bottom of the vertical posts 241 abut sole respectively The upper and lower surface of body, the upper end of vertical posts 241 is in inverted triangular structure, is conducted to greatest extent beneficial to by foot pressure To vertical posts 241, while the spherical structure of anti-skid ball 3 also has the characteristics of force dispersion is uniform, on the one hand can be by foot pressure Diffusion, on the other hand the recoil strength on ground can be concentrated conducted to vertical posts 241.
Vertically the above-below direction of post 241 is arranged the transverse post 242 at equal intervals, similar rich word structure, i.e., two neighboring transverse direction There is sole body support between post 242, the vertical posts 241 and transverse post 242 leave gap with shock structure groove 25 and subtracted to provide Shake post spring and become space, in this way, when sole body is by pedal force, transverse post 242 is understood after stress to retracted downward deformation, by There is sole body support in the lower surface of each transverse post 242, therefore will not only continue deformation downwards, there are a footwear on the contrary Copy for the record or for reproduction body produces a upward support force, the upward support force and the ground reaction transmitted from anti-skid ball 3 to transverse post 242 Power is collectively forming the power for promoting human body to advance, and to sum up, the present invention has damping performance and support performance concurrently, is unlikely to deform, durable.
As another preferred scheme of the present invention, as shown in Fig. 7,9, the lower surface of the sole body is also convexly equipped with some Individual five jiaos of Non-slip materials 31, specifically in the shape of positive five-pointed star, five jiaos of Non-slip materials 31 will by bisector of wherein one diagonal The lower surface of five jiaos of Non-slip materials 31 is divided into the first contacting surface 311 and the second contacting surface 312, and the level height of first contacting surface 311 is low In the level height of the second contacting surface 312, when so trampling the water surface, the first contacting surface 311 first lands, now, and water is from the first contacting surface 311 and second contacting surface 312 exist difference in height gap flow through, i.e., the whole water surface is separated by five jiaos of Non-slip materials 31, so as to destroy The shaping fluid film of water, reaches anti-skidding effect.
It is highly preferred that several described five jiaos of Non-slip materials 31 are arranged successively along sole body left and right directions and fore-and-aft direction respectively Row form jiao Non-slip material of linear multiple lines and multiple rows, i.e., five 31 and alignd one by one row along sole body left and right directions and fore-and-aft direction Row, the bisector of each five jiaos of Non-slip materials 31 points to the left and right directions of sole body, and the first contacting surface of each five jiaos of Non-slip materials 31 311 are located at the upside or downside of the bisector, that is, ensure five jiaos of all Non-slip materials 31 all in the same side of bisector, In this way, the second higher contacting surface 312 of multiple height forms a plurality of pipelined channel in the left and right directions of sole body so that flow direction The water of second contacting surface 312 can take advantage of a situation and be discharged by pipelined channel from the left and right sides of sole body.In addition, the second contacting surface 312 The higher namely thickness of height is smaller, and the contacting surface 311 of the second contacting surface 312 to the first compares high, the side wall of the first contacting surface 311 There is side wall of the part not with the first contacting surface 311 mutually to support, thus it is more yielding, therefore the stream formed by the second contacting surface 312 Aquaporin is actually more prone to bending, so as to allow sole to keep flexibility and ductility, improves sole wearing comfort.
Internal malleolus stress is more than external malleolus stress during due to foot motion, it is highly preferred that as shown in fig. 7, the sole body point Make region malleolaris medialis and region malleolaris lateralis, the column pitch for being distributed in five jiaos of Non-slip materials 31 of multiple row of region malleolaris lateralis is more than the multiple row for being distributed in region malleolaris medialis The column pitch of five jiaos of Non-slip materials 31, and the arch portion of region malleolaris medialis does not arrange five jiaos of Non-slip materials 31, in this way, five jiaos of Non-slip materials 31 exist Region malleolaris medialis arranges more crypto set, more loose thin in region malleolaris lateralis arrangement so that region malleolaris medialis is more stronger than the frictional force of region malleolaris lateralis, to adapt to footwear The loading characteristic of external malleolus in copy for the record or for reproduction body.
Making the present invention can have the multiple materials such as MD, TPU, rubber, EVA available, in order to which above-mentioned effect is better achieved Really, TPU material wear-resistants, bearing capacity are strong, and hardness range is wide, and the sole body uses elastomeric material injection molding, and described the One ventilative column 131 and ventilative outer tube 141 is using the shaping of hard TPU material injections, the shock structure 24, the and of the first air-permeable mattress 11 Second air-permeable mattress 12 is molded using soft TPU material injections, and the hardness of hard TPU materials is more than the hardness of elastomeric material, rubber The hardness of material is more than the hardness of soft TPU materials.
Specifically, the hardness of shock structure is less than the hardness of sole body, and such sole body hardness can strengthen greatly carrying energy Power and conformal ability, coordinate shock structure, and can take into account damping performance, especially shock structure has the branch of sole body during bullet change It is conformal more longlasting under support.
In addition, the first ventilative column 131 and the hardness of ventilative outer tube 141 are conducive to conformal more than sole body, first is ventilative The hardness of the air-permeable mattress 12 of pad 11 and second is also smaller than the hardness of sole body can to keep the steadiness of sole body, while in pin Toe position and heel position keep soft comfortable sense.
Finally, five jiaos of Non-slip materials are made using elastomeric material, and elastomeric material wear-resisting antiskid, five jiaos of Non-slip materials are adopted Made of elastomeric material, the hardness of the second contacting surface is more than the hardness of sole body, the hardness of sole body is more than the first contacting surface Hardness, in this way, the first contacting surface is more yielding during bending, the second contacting surface is that whole sole is provided a supporting, so that sole is effectively simultaneous Turn round and look at bending property and support performance.
Foot motion amount maximum is toe joint position, pin rear palma position and heel position, due to existing shoe-pad Surfacing, therefore above-mentioned position only supports by shoe last surface, underbraced and compactness is not high.Shown in reference picture 10, the footwear Pad has insole body 51, plays matter pad 52 and the sufficient block 53 of two pieces of shields, and the sufficient block 53 of this two pieces shields symmetrically sets up separately in insole body The both sides at 51 toe joint position, can be stable between the sufficient block 53 of two pieces of shields by pin, and toe section is by leaning on the sufficient block 53 of shield just It is difficult off normal to sprain, plays firm effect.Specifically, sufficient block 53 is protected to be bonded with insole body 51 with strong adhesive.And two The opposite face of the sufficient block 53 of block shield is in cambered surface, i.e., the face contacted with pin is higher with foot compactness in cambered surface.
The hind paw position of the insole body 51 is to heel position one U-shaped recess 54 of formation, and the U-shaped recess 54 can be with Heel is wrapped up entirely so that heel is steadily placed in U-shaped recess 54, can effectively buffer heel and insole body 51 is applied Plus pressure.
Two gussets of the U-shaped recess 54 open up storage tank 541 respectively, and storage tank 541 is provided with zipper opening 5411, the bullet Matter pad 52 is dismantled and assembled to be inserted in the storage tank 541 and matches setting with storage tank 541, and the bullet matter pad 52 has one outwards Arch upward the cambered surfaces of α radians, wherein, the α radians are 0 °, 10 ° or 20 °, are selected, will had according to the pin shape feature of people In the insertion storage tank 541 of bullet matter pad 52 of different radian cambered surfaces, and sealed using zipper opening 5411.Play matter pad 52 peculiar The motion state that can be slapped according to the characteristics of the pin shape of people and after pin of elastic property fitted all the time with the palm after pin, after being pin The both sides of the palm provide support force, improve the stability slapped after pin.
As the preferred scheme of the present invention, the insole body 51 includes playing matter silica gel strip 55, some rigid support bars 56 and moisture absorption packing 57, the toe portion of the insole body 51 is provided with fan-shaped deep gouge 511, straight in the fan-shaped deep gouge 511 The centre position on side is formed with arcuation deep gouge 5111, more specifically, the arcuation deep gouge 5111 is just corresponded at the toe joint of people. The bullet matter silica gel strip 55 is embedded in the arcuation deep gouge 5111 and matched with the shape of arcuation deep gouge 5111, in this, Elastic silica gel pad is just corresponding with toe joint position, therefore in walking process, elastic silica gel pad can just absorb when stopping over The power that is bent at toe joint and be toe joint screen resilience in foot-up, with shock-absorbing boosting function so that the toe of people is closed Indefatigability is saved, feel is soft.
It is spaced some rigid support bars 56 to be separated out several strip deep gouges along the arc side of fan-shaped deep gouge 511 5112, the moisture absorption packing 57 is embedded in the strip deep gouge 5112 and matched with the shape of rigid support bar 56, In specific production, the width of strip deep gouge 5112 is most preferably be hard amount support bar twice so that the face of moisture absorption filling block Product is larger to strengthen moisture pick-up properties.In this way, rigid support bar 56 is laid in whole toe portion with the interval of moisture absorption packing 57, from And the moisture absorption packing 57 on a large scale can sop up foot's sweat, the moisture pick-up properties of whole sole is greatly improved, while hard branch Stay 56 can then carry toe portion, improve the intensity of toe portion, effectively prevent ball of foot from spraining.Wherein, it is described to inhale Wet packing 57 is the strip shape body that coconut palm palpus material is suppressed, and has the advantages that low cost.So far, whole toe portion has suction concurrently It is wet perspiration wicking, alleviate toe joint fatigue, while Stability Analysis of Structures anti-sprain.
To sum up, the motion principle and state of the invention according to foot, in the toe that foot motion amount is larger and easily sprains Joint part, toe portion, pin rear palma position and heel parts are respectively provided with safeguard measure, by protecting sufficient block 53, rigid support Bar 56, moisture absorption packing 57, U-shaped recess 54 and the organic cooperation for playing matter pad 52, can be whole to whole pin omnibearing protection Pin, it is to avoid various to sprain situation.
As another preferred scheme of the present invention, as shown in figure 11, the lower surface of insole body 51 is embedded support pad 58, the polyline shaped that the both sides of support pad 58 are symmetrical set, the hardness of support pad 58 is bigger than insole body 51, makees with conformal With polyline shaped is more conducive to insole body 51 and bent.
Wherein, the insole body 51 uses EVA material injection molding, soft comfortable.Due to the hardness range of TPU materials Compare wide, the sufficient block 53 of the rigid support bar 56, shield and support pad 58 are using the shaping of TPU material injections.In this way, both protecting The flexibility of insole body 51 is demonstrate,proved, while thering is the sufficient block 53 of the higher rigid support bar 56 of hardness, shield and support pad 58 to carry For the support force bigger compared to insole body 51.
